leig2
/lɔʔig/
adj_rt.
“undercooked”
 
vi.
for food (such as corn, sweet potato, or cassava) (egkaleig, naleig) to be undercooked (usually on the fire)
Naleig ka tinuug ku ne aheley, sika ka eg-etuten a su meyilew pad.
The corn that I placed on the fire was still uncooked, that's why I'm always passing wind because it was still raw.
Eng. undercooked; not cooked properly; not fully cooked; rare (not fully cooked); rawish
Ceb. hilaw
